## Deploying the Gatewick Proctor Queue

Deploys are pretty painless: push to main, wait for the pipeline, then watch the queue drain dashboard for five minutes. If candidates pile up mid-exam, roll back first and ask questions later — the queue replays safely. Everything the workers care about lives in one config block, shown here for reference.

settings of bafof-yagef:
JOROX_PIN=8740
JOROX_TENANT=pelox
JOROX_METRICS_HOST=metrics.jorox.qorvelworks.internal
JOROX_SEAL=seal_c78f63c1
JOROX_STANDBY_TEAM=norax

Quarterly Planning Note — Divestiture of the Coastal Tooling Unit

For the finance team: the sale of the Coastal Tooling unit to Pellmark Industries remains on track for close in Q3. Please finalize the carve-out balance sheet, reconcile intercompany positions, and prepare the working-capital adjustment schedule by month-end. Audit support requests should be prioritized. For planning purposes, note the following sensitive item:

internal memo for hawef-kahif: The finance team signed off on a budget of $25.9 million for Project Sorox. The renewal with Pelokek Logistics closes at $51.7 million a year, 52 percent below the last contract.

### Step 2: Point the solver at the new cluster

Alright, now that the Timberlyn timetable solver data is migrated, you need to swap the solver over to the new scheduling cluster. Don't skip the dry run — the solver will happily generate a full term's timetable against stale room data, and untangling that is a miserable afternoon. Run the validation pass first, check the conflict report is empty, then restart the workers. When that's green, update the solver with the values below.

deployment values, bagaf-kagag:
istael:
  pin: 2777
  tenant: tamvan
  seal: seal_75cefd5e
  metrics_host: metrics.istael.qirvanio.example
  standby_team: holion
  escalation: kelmir-drudor
  nonce: d13cd7

## Stock-Count Ledger Transport — Receiving Notes

Heads up, Milton Street team: the quarterly stock-count ledger for Farrow & Dent comes over from the Westhollow warehouse at the end of each count week. It travels in the blue zip wallet — one book, hand-written, no copies, so treat it gently. Check the wallet seal on arrival and sign the transit slip before the courier leaves. The hand-over itself should go exactly as follows.

handover note for yagef-bagep: the drudor pelius courier leaves the kasdor zorvan norir ledger at gate 8016 under passcode 755406